Based on 280 recent sales, the median property price is £193,875 (about £239 per square foot) in Bramley & Stanningley area, with individual transactions ranging from £32,519 up to £452,000.
| Type | Sales | Median | £/sq ft |
|---|---|---|---|
| Detached | 21 | £330,000 | £327 |
| Semi-Detached | 97 | £220,000 | £268 |
| Terraced | 133 | £177,000 | £218 |
| Flats | 29 | £128,000 | £224 |

Postcode LS13 1RD is located in a rural town, within the Bramley & Stanningley ward of Leeds in the Yorkshire and The Humber region, and forms part of the Bramley Fall area. It has high deprivation and very high crime levels, with around 105.6 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, in line with the Yorkshire and The Humber average of 113 per 1,000. The average income per household in Bramley Fall is £43,602 per year. The nearest station is Kirkstall Forge, about 0.2 miles away. There are 7 primary and no secondary schools in the area.
Bramley Fall has a high level of deprivation, ranked at position 11,979 out of 32,844 areas in the United Kingdom, placing it within the top 36% most deprived areas in England.
